Maraschino Cherry Chocolate Chip Cookies

Maraschino Cherry Chocolate Chip Cookies are a bakery-style delight with a pop of cherry sweetness and rich chocolate indulgence. The maraschino cherries not only add a beautiful pink hue but also deliver a juicy, fruity contrast to the melty chocolate chips.

These cookies are perfect for Valentine’s Day, Christmas cookie trays, or anytime you’re craving a colorful twist on the classic chocolate chip cookie. They’re soft, chewy, and guaranteed to disappear fast. Pair with a glass of milk or a cozy cup of tea for maximum comfort.

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• ¾ cup brown sugar, packed
  • ½ cup granulated s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 2 ¾ c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
  • ¾ cup chopped maraschino cherries (drained and patted dry)
  • Optional: 1–2 tablespoons cherry juice for extra flavor

Directions:

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Line baking sheets with parchment paper.
  2. In a large bowl, cream butter, brown sugar, and granulated sugar until light and fluffy.
  3. Beat in eggs one at a time, then add vanilla extract. Mix until smooth.
  4. In a separate bowl, whisk flour, baking soda, and salt. Gradually add dry mixture to the wet ingredients and mix until combined.
  5. Fold in chocolate chips and chopped maraschino cherries. If desired, stir in cherry juice for extra cherry flavor.
  6. Drop rounded tablespoons of dough onto baking sheets, spacing 2 inches apart.
  7. Bake for 10–12 minutes or until edges are lightly golden. Centers may look slightly soft.
  8. Cool on ba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ring to wire racks.

Prep Time: 15 minutes | Baking Time: 12 minutes | Total Time: 27 minutes
Kcal: 210 kcal | Servings: 24 cookies
